Output 83cd3dc1b8a7df0453c31f8edee9102f305d2372e7e031ece452ebee683d0aa5:3

value
106063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4d582eb35607b04726930e59a27d0c397e3017 OP_EQUAL
address
3JmNwQMgPtW6nKzHos8CNFp9rssWvKZFKv
transaction
83cd3dc1b8a7df0453c31f8edee9102f305d2372e7e031ece452ebee683d0aa5
spent
true